Market Snapshot: Laboratory Mixer Market Size, Growth, and Outlook
The laboratory mixer market grew from USD 1.90 billion in 2024 to USD 2.02 billion in 2025, supported by steady demand across research and manufacturing settings. With a projected comp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.06%, the market is expected to reach USD 3.05 billion by 2032. Ongoing expansion is attributed to rising demand for high-precision mixers across pharmaceutical, life sciences, chemical, and food industries. Advancements in laboratory automation and increasingly stringent quality and compliance expectations are driving both product development and investment. As laboratory research diversifies, organizations are prioritizing mixers that offer process traceability, flexible integration, and support for increasingly complex experimental requirements.

Key Takeaways for Strategic Decision-Making
- Laboratory mixer adoption is accelerating in biopharmaceuticals and advanced research environments, where process precision and data traceability increasingly influence purchasing priorities.
- Emerging preferences for modular designs and digital control interfaces allow laboratories to adapt quickly to varying process requirements and facilitate seamless integration with broader digital laboratory management systems.
- Sustainability considerations are reshaping procurement strategies, elevating the focus on energy-efficient devices and solvent or reagent reduction in equipment selection.
- Demand for mixers supporting cell culture, nanoparticle synthesis, and personalized medicine highlights the increasing requirements for contamination control and replicable results.
- Geographic dynamics show that regulatory initiatives drive growth in Europe, infrastructure modernization fuels demand in Asia-Pacific, and cost optimization remains pivotal across the Americas.
Tariff Impact: United States Tariffs and Supply Chain Response
Recent United States tariff adjustments, effective 2025, have introduced new complexity to global laboratory mixer supply chains. Manufacturers and suppliers have responded by diversifying sourcing strategies, relocating production, and fostering alliances with both domestic and regional partners. There is a growing emphasis on transparency, risk mitigation through dual sourcing, and holistic service agreements as organizations seek to ensure ongoing quality and reliability amidst evolving trade landscapes. These measures protect procurement operations and reduce potential disruptions associated with cost variability or delivery delays.
